세계의 정형외과용 골이식편(BGS) 시장 규모는 2024년에 약 28억 3,000만 달러에 달했습니다. 이 시장은 4.1%의 CAGR로 확대하며, 2031년에는 약 37억 5,000만 달러에 달할 것으로 예측됩니다. 이 시장에는 정형외과, 외상, 재건 수술에 사용되는 다양한 유형의 골 정형외과용 골이식재가 포함됩니다.
COVID-19 팬데믹으로 인해 선택적 수술이 연기되면서 BGS의 매출은 감소했습니다. 그러나 시장은 2022년까지 강력하게 회복되어 안정적인 성장을 재개했습니다. 저침습적 기술이 기존 골이식술보다 합성골 및 DBM 기반 이식편의 채택을 촉진하고 있습니다. 고령화와 외상 증가로 인한 정형외과수술 증가가 시장 성장을 촉진하고 있습니다. 생체공학적 골이식재의 기술 발전은 이식 효율과 환자 결과를 개선하고 있습니다.

The global bone graft substitute (BGS) market was valued at approximately $2.83 billion in 2024 and is expected to grow at a CAGR of 4.1%, reaching approximately $3.75 billion by 2031. The market includes various types of bone graft substitutes used in orthopedic, trauma, and reconstructive surgeries.
The BGS market is segmented into:
Allograft BGS
Demineralized Bone Matrix (DBM) Allograft BGS
Synthetic BGS
The market is further categorized based on indication type:
Spine (Cervical, Thoracolumbar)
Trauma (Non-union, Fresh Fracture)
Large Joint Reconstruction (Hip, Knee)
Craniomaxillofacial
Oncology
Foot Bone Reconstructions

Market Trends
The COVID-19 pandemic caused a decline in BGS sales due to postponed elective surgeries. However, the market recovered strongly by 2022 and resumed steady growth.
Minimally invasive techniques are driving the adoption of synthetic and DBM-based grafts over traditional bone grafting procedures.
Rising orthopedic procedures due to an aging population and increasing trauma-related injuries are fueling market growth.
Technological advancements in bioengineered bone grafts are increasing graft efficiency and patient outcomes.
Market Share Insights
Top Competitors in the Global Bone Graft Substitute Market (2024):
1 Medtronic
* Market leader due to a dominant share in the DBM and synthetic BGS segments.
* Grafton(R) - The first fiber-based DBM allograft BGS and one of the most widely used.
* MASTERGRAFT(R) - Synthetic BGS product line available in granules, moldable putty, flexible strip, and matrix EXT.
2 Stryker
* Second-largest competitor in the market.
* Offers multiple BGS products including Vitoss(TM), ALLOMATRIX(R), FUSIONFLEX(R), and PRO-STIM(R).
3 DePuy Synthes (Johnson & Johnson)
* Third-largest competitor in the BGS market.
* Competes with its DBX(R) DBM product line and chronOS(R) synthetic BGS.
